Understanding PayPal Charges and Fees

Introduction

PayPal is a widely used online payment platform that allows individuals and businesses to send and receive money securely. However, when using PayPal for transactions, users often encounter various charges and fees. In this article, we will delve into the details of PayPal charges and fees to help you understand how they work.

PayPal Transaction Fees

When you use PayPal for transactions, you may come across different types of fees. These fees include PayPal charges, PayPal currency conversion fees, and PayPal commission rates. It is essential to have a clear understanding of these fees to avoid any surprises.

PayPal Charges

PayPal charges can vary based on factors such as the type of transaction, the currency involved, and the sender/receivers location. For example, if you are wondering how much PayPal charges for converting USD to INR (Indian Rupee), it is important to check the latest fee structure on PayPals website.

PayPal Fees in India

For users in India, understanding PayPal fees is crucial, especially for international transactions. PayPal charges in India may include fees for receiving money internationally and currency conversion fees for transactions involving different currencies.

Availability of PayPal in India

PayPal is indeed available in India for international transactions, making it convenient for users to send and receive money globally. However, it is essential to be aware of the associated fees to make informed decisions while using the platform.
